Insertion sequences disrupting mgrB in carbapenem-resistant Klebsiella pneumoniae strains in Brazil.

Abstract

OBJECTIVES: This study aimed to characterise insertional mutations disturbing themgrB gene in carbapenem-resistant Klebsiella pneumoniae (CRKp).
METHODS: A total of 118 clinical CRKp isolates were surveyed for polymyxin resistance and insertion sequence (IS) elements disruptingmgrB.
RESULTS: Of the 118 isolates, 78 (66.1%) displayed polymyxin resistance, of which 54% (42/78) hadmgrB::IS inserts. Sequencing analyses showed 13 insertion sites in mgrB. mgrB::ISSen4(IS3) was observed for the first time in CRKp.
CONCLUSIONS: Ten different IS elements disruptedmgrB, with a predominance (76%) of IS5 sequences.
